Can anybody suggest a via zone 1 journey, which would not involve
gates?
You can transfer between NR/OG and the Underground at a number of points
without going through gates, and Farringdon is a rare case where that
can happen inside zone 1. A lot of other lines pass through zone 1 so
any journey through the zone and out the other side is a possibility.
Farringdon (for Thameslink), Moorgate and Old Street (for Great
Northern) are the only three examples I can think of now in z1.
Although the Waterloo & City at Waterloo has no barriers can you get to any
other platforms there without passing through barriers now?
